Threading...

I think I'm doing this wrong :

I have a class with a public shared method such as follows:

public shared sub myFunction
dim frm as new myFrm
dim t as new Threading.Thread(Addressof myFrm.myShowDialog
t.start
end sub

In the frm - the myShowDialog just does a "me.showdialog".

The idea is that this function will display a form, but then return control
back to the calling routine immediately without waiting for the form to be
closed.

It works, but I've had several reports of the form that is displayed
"crashing" as it is being displayed, with random errors (I've not got a
sample) or the whole application just disappearing (without error).

Can anybody assist, either by confirming or otherwise that what I'm doing is
reasonable, or perhaps letting me know a better way.

Simon Verona wrote:
I think I'm doing this wrong :

I have a class with a public shared method such as follows:

public shared sub myFunction
dim frm as new myFrm
dim t as new Threading.Thread(Addressof myFrm.myShowDialog
t.start
end sub

In the frm - the myShowDialog just does a "me.showdialog".

The idea is that this function will display a form, but then return control
back to the calling routine immediately without waiting for the form to be
closed.
If this is what you want, why not just .Show (rather than .ShowDialog)
the form? Anyway...
>
It works, but I've had several reports of the form that is displayed
"crashing" as it is being displayed, with random errors (I've not got a
sample) or the whole application just disappearing (without error).

Can anybody assist, either by confirming or otherwise that what I'm doing is
reasonable, or perhaps letting me know a better way.
I think you are falling foul of the rule whereby UI elements cannot be
safely interacted with from threads other than their 'owning' thread -
that on which they are created. So here the myFrm is created on the
thread that enters this procedure, but then passed to a different
thread to show itself. Thus this second thread will be accessing UI
elements it didn't create -bad.

The fix (if there are deeper reasons why you need to do this sort of
thing) is to move the form creation from before thread-creation to
after it. That is, at the moment you are saying:

Create form
Create thread (giving it the form)
Start thread - thread goes on to show form

Instead you should say

Create thread
Start thread - thread goes on to create form, then show it.

Probably the logical place for this new routine would be a Shared
procedure in myFrm:

Public Shared Sub NewShowDialog
Dim f As New myFrm
f.ShowDialog
End Sub

then replace your current myFunction with

Dim t As New Thread(AddressOf myFrm.NewShowDialog)
t.Start

But please first consider my first question about .Show vs
..ShowDialog...

Simon Verona wrote:
See my previous reply, I've had problem with the form disappearing when the
subroutine exits... (I'm presuming the object is killed on exit?)
I'd be tempted to go back and re-examine that situation, to be honest.
To paint with a *very* broad brush, multi-threading is something you
shouldn't do unless you quite obviously _must_.
>
I understand what you are saying about the frm creation and use being on
seperate threads. I must admit to not thinking of having a shared entry on
the form to display itself!
The thought process there was that the behaviour of <creating a new
myFrm and displaying itclearly 'belongs to' the myFrm class, but not
to any particular instance of it =shared method.

Simon...

All of this really depends on your architecture. Is this routine that
is showing the form on a background thread? If it is, that would
explain why the form exits when the routine ends. If it is on a
background thread, there is no message pump and the form will exit when
the routine ends because the thread exits.

Here is three different methods of showing a form:

Simon Verona wrote:
<snip>
I have a class with a public shared method such as follows:

public shared sub myFunction
dim frm as new myFrm
dim t as new Threading.Thread(Addressof myFrm.myShowDialog
t.start
end sub

In the frm - the myShowDialog just does a "me.showdialog".

The idea is that this function will display a form, but then return control
back to the calling routine immediately without waiting for the form to be
closed.

It works, but I've had several reports of the form that is displayed
"crashing" as it is being displayed, with random errors (I've not got a
sample) or the whole application just disappearing (without error).
<snip>

It's an error to access the method of a class derived from Control
(which is the case of Form) from a thread other than the one where the
object was created. You must use the object's InvokeRequired method to
check if you're being called from another thread and if so
(InvokeRequired returned True), use Invoke to call the desired method.
The 'pattern' is somewhat like this:

'in myForm
'Must have the same signature of MyShowDialog
Delegate Sub MyShowDialogCallback(Param as Integer)
'...
Sub MyShowDialog(Param As Integer)
Static This As MyShowDialogCallback = AddressOf MyShowDialog
If InvokeRequired Then
BeginInvoke(This, New Object() {Param} )
Else
'Do your thing
'blah, blah, blah
ShowDialog
End If
End Sub
